Nancy Ann Dieter

May 13, 2021 by Fillmore County Journal

Nancy Dieter obituary, Fillmore County Journal

Nancy Ann Dieter, 58, passed away peacefully in her home in Harmony, Minn., on the morning of May 12, 2021. She was surrounded by her family and loved ones.

Nancy was born July 3, 1962, to Raphael “Ray” and Gladys (Frana) Ferrie. She graduated from Crestwood High School in 1980. Nancy was married to John Dieter for 29 years and together they had two children, Michael and Bethany. Nancy soon discovered her passion for business management in Oklahoma, briefly managing a couple businesses before moving back to the Cresco area where she then managed the Kum & Go gas station. From there she was offered a store leader position at the first Kwik Star in the Cresco area where she worked for over 10 years. After Kwik Star she became store leader at Goodwill Industries in Decorah, Iowa, a job she absolutely loved, for 14 years until she was no longer able to work.

Nancy enjoyed spending time with family and friends any chance she had, especially enjoying her grandsons, whom she adored wholeheartedly. She loved to go to garage sales, fishing, kayaking, dancing, and playing cards, and was always very lucky at slot machines. She was an avid collector of many things such as cookie jars, paperweights, and Fenton glass baskets. Many would say she acquired the love for collecting from her mother. She touched so many people’s hearts and will be deeply missed by all of the people she loved so very much.

Nancy is survived by her mother Gladys Ferrie, brothers Dean (Ann), Kenneth (Carol), Kevin, Russell (Cindy), and Roger (Kari) Ferrie; children Michael (Jerralyn) and Bethany Dieter, and grandchildren Dodge and Asher Dieter.

She was preceded in death by her sister Amy, sister-in-law Deborah Ferrie, and father Raphael Ferrie.

A Celebration of Life will be held on July 3, 2021, at 3650 Fog Rd., Cresco, Iowa 52136.

Cards and condolences can be mailed to 530 Main Ave N Harmony, Minn. 55939.

Online condolences may be left at Hindtfuneralhomes.com.
